Output d3b32ac3cd7d7a8aeaa54843eb5db91d4bd16c7a0826a4af623d312d629d38f6:2

value
2079681
script pubkey
OP_0 OP_PUSHBYTES_20 ca587ed00856908ff27f6e99c9cd3daf7a215b44
address
bc1qefv8a5qg26gglunld6vunnfa4aazzk6ydc6482
transaction
d3b32ac3cd7d7a8aeaa54843eb5db91d4bd16c7a0826a4af623d312d629d38f6